Synopsis: All Good Things – Nollywood Movie
In the vibrant city of Lagos, Nigeria, amidst the chaotic hustle and bustle, the lives of three individuals collide, leading them on a journey of love, sacrifice, and self-discovery. “All Good Things” is an enchanting Nollywood film that beautifully captures the essence of contemporary Nigerian society and explores the complexities of human relationships.
The Stars of All Good Things – Nollywood Movie
With a star-studded cast, “All Good Things” showcases the immense talent of some of Nollywood’s finest actors. Renowned actress Funke Akindele-Bello takes on the role of Linda, a strong-willed woman determined to break free from societal constraints. Alongside her, Femi Jacobs portrays the charismatic and ambitious Tony, a successful entrepreneur with a troubled past. Finally, Nse Ikpe-Etim brings the character of Ada to life, an independent and compassionate woman whose choices will shape the destinies of those around her.
The Journey of Love and Sacrifice
As their paths intertwine, Linda, Tony, and Ada find themselves embarking on a tumultuous journey filled with love, sacrifice, and difficult choices. Linda, trapped in an oppressive marriage, must summon the courage to liberate herself and pursue her dreams. Tony, haunted by a mistake in his past, strives for redemption and is faced with the ultimate test of sacrifice. Meanwhile, Ada, torn between her own desires and the welfare of her loved ones, navigates a precarious path to find true happiness.
